- Qumulo, headquartered in Seattle, Washington, is a leading provider of enterprise cloud storage management software, recognized for its innovative data management solutions that unify exabyte-scale data across cloud, edge, and data center environments.
- In the past year, Qumulo has achieved record bookings and growth, delivering profitable net operating income and expanding its product portfolio, including the launch of the Scale Anywhere™ platform and enhancements to its cloud-native file service.
- The company serves over 1,100 customers across diverse industries such as Media and Entertainment, Healthcare, and Financial Services, and has established partnerships with major players like HPE and Cisco to enhance its data management capabilities.

Qumulo's workforce is organized across 12 departments, with a significant concentration in Information Technology, which comprises 194 employees. Engineering follows with 51 employees, while Operations and Sales contribute 40 and 38 employees, respectively. The geographic distribution of Qumulo's workforce is heavily concentrated in Seattle, Washington, which houses 196 employees. Other locations, including San Jose and Bellevue, contribute minimally with only 4 employees each. The 'Other' category accounts for a substantial 290 employees, indicating a significant remote or distributed workforce.
